What is a Casino Online?

A casino online, also known as an internet casino or virtual casino, is a digital platform that offers various forms of gambling games, such as slots, roulette, blackjack, and poker, to players over the internet. Unlike traditional brick-and-mortar casinos, online casinos operate solely on the web and can be accessed from anywhere with an active internet connection.

Types or Variations

There are several types of casino online platforms:

  • Download-based casinos : Players download software onto their computers to access games.
  • Flash casinos : Games are delivered via Adobe Flash and can be played directly in web browsers without the need for downloads.
  • Mobile casinos : Optimized mobile apps allow players to access games on smartphones or tablets.

Real Money vs Free Play Differences

Key differences between playing with real money and using free play options include:

  • Risk : Wagering real money exposes players to financial risks, which do not apply in demo mode.
  • Winning potential : Real money stakes mean wins are converted into cash payouts, whereas free spins or credits have no monetary value.

Risks and Responsible Considerations

To gamble responsibly online:

  • Age verification : Operators verify player age to prevent minors from accessing gaming content
  • Deposit limits : Self-imposed deposit limits can mitigate financial risk
  • Responsible gaming tools : Players can access self-assessment quizzes or take steps to limit their exposure
